
Sam Carter
Sam Carter is the frontman and vocalist of the British metalcore band Architects, known for his powerful and emotional singing style. Over the years, Carter has navigated personal and collective grief within the band, particularly following the death of guitarist Tom Searle, his close friend and bandmate. He is candid about his struggles with mental health and uses his platform to address complex themes in the band's music, including societal issues and environmental concerns.
